Letters of Recommendation
As part of the online application form, you are asked to provide the names and contact details of two referees. As soon as you have entered the names and contact details of your referees, we will automatically send them an e-mail with a link, requesting that they provide us with their letter of recommendation through our online system.
Please be aware that the deadline for your referees to submit their letters of recommendation is the same as the application deadline. Therefore, you need to make sure that you register with the online system and enter the contact details of your referees in good time, so that they have time to submit their letters before the deadline. It is your responsibility to ensure these letters are provided.
Evaluation Process and Selection
Applications will be evaluated within five weeks after the deadline. We will inform all applicants about the outcome of the evaluation and shortlisted candidates will be invited to the PhD Selection. They will receive access to PhD project proposals to select up to five preferred projects. for which they wish to interview. In addition, candidates will be asked to upload a short video of themselves in which they introduce themselves and summarize their previous research experience. During the interviews, aspects such as intellectual brightness, creativity, perseverance, independent thinking and the ability to work in a team will be evaluated. Candidates of the selection are expected to participate in two online panel interviews of 3 senior scientists where they will be asked to:
- give a short presentation of a recent research project (typically their master's thesis) and answer general questions
- give a short presentation of a publication (selected from a pool of publications provided by the PhD Program Office in due time before the interview phase) and answer general questions
During the interview phase, candidates will receive further information on PhD studies at the DKFZ by the PhD Program Manager, and will have opportunities to talk to lab members of potential PhD supervisors and current DKFZ PhD students.

Re-application
If you have previously submitted an online application for the PhD Program and were NOT invited for interviews, then you are eligible to re-apply. You will need to create a new account in the online system and re-submit all your documents, including the letters of recommendation. It is not possible for you to "re-use" a previous application.
If you have previously submitted an online application for the PhD Program and WERE invited for interviews, but were unable to obtain a position, then you are NOT eligible to re-apply through the online application system. Instead, we encourage you to contact PhD supervisors directly.
Candidates who were invited for online interviews of the Summer Selection 2020 are exempt from this rule and may apply again.
Application from candidates already affiliated with the DKFZ
Candidates who are currently working at or have previously worked at the DKFZ are eligible to apply through the online system. However, they must indicate in the supplementary information that they are working (or have worked) at the DKFZ and provide details.
Candidates who have already secured third-party funding and wish to apply for PhD Program funding may apply providing that they started their PhD no earlier than the application deadline of the previous selection round. Details of their affiliation with the DKFZ must also be clearly stated in their online application.
